Replacing your roof involves several variables that shift your final bill. The total square footage of your property is the biggest factor, followed closely by the pitch or steepness of your roof, which dictates how safely crews can work. You will also need to choose your materials—architectural shingles, metal, or tile each carry different price points. We also have to account for the removal and disposal of your current roof, plus the condition of the underlying wood decking that might need repairs once the old shingles are off. Installing metal roofing in Miami starts with preparing the roof deck and installing a protective underlayment. Metal panels are then carefully secured, often with concealed fasteners for a sleek look and enhanced water resistance.
